Hardline founder DJ Cosworth comes to The Croft for a defining All Night Long, journeying through UKG, House, Speedy G, Hardgroove and more.
As a DJ, producer, label boss, designer and online record store co-founder, Bristol-based DJ Cosworth has become an integral and multi-disciplined outlet for unfettered club culture. His music sounds like the amalgam of every white-label record shop find, connecting and mashing up any number of sounds heard in UK Garage, Organ House, Speed Garage, Dembow and Hardgroove into a bare-bones body workout. Spending years digging on YouTube and Discogs has resulted in club music that knowingly absorbs its history and drips with a dark, dubby vapour. Between his main alias and more wrist-wafting tunes as Vibes Kartel, Cosworth has released on Hot Haus, E-Beamz, Locked On Records and his own label Hardline.
As head honcho of Hardline, his label traffics in “no-nonsense club music” and has platformed the likes of Interplanetary Criminal, Dylan Fogarty, Amor Satyr and Silva Bumpa. Not just a label, Hardline has also visually extended into a clothing line designed by Cosworth himself and part of a growing vinyl distribution empire, Untitled Distribution, in collaboration with fellow Bristol label ec2a.
